The right to sell a product or service is the franchise. Here are some primary types of franchises for new franchise owners.


9 Simple Techniques For Accounting Franchise


For example, vehicle car dealerships are item and trade-name franchises that sell items generated by the franchisor. The most prevalent kind of franchise business in the United States are item or distribution franchises, comprising the biggest proportion of total retail sales. Business-format franchises typically include every little thing required to start and run a service in one complete plan.




Numerous familiar ease stores and fast-food outlets, as an example, are franchised in this fashion. A conversion franchise is when a well established business ends up being a franchise business by authorizing an agreement to embrace a franchise business brand name and operational system. Company owners seek this to enhance brand acknowledgment, boost purchasing power, take advantage of new markets and clients, accessibility robust operational procedures and training, and increase resale value.

It is necessary to be conscious of the downsides connected with purchasing and operating a franchise business. If you are considering purchasing a franchise business, it is essential to consider the complying with disadvantages of franchising.


The expense of lots of franchise business consists of a monthly nobility (cost) based on a percentage of the franchisee's income or sales and should be paid also if the company is not successful. Franchise contracts generally determine exactly how the franchise business operates. The franchisee company website should follow the criteria in the franchise arrangement, which consequently leaves the franchisee with little control over the operation, consisting of branding and advertising and marketing.
